>> About the sanlock issue - it reappeared with errors like :
>> 2019-01-31 13:33:10 27551 [17279]: leader1 delta_acquire_begin error -223
>> lockspace hosted-engine host_id 1
>>
>
> As I said, the error is not -233, but -223, which make sense - this error
> means sanlock did not
> find the magic number for a delta lease area, which means the area was not
> formatted, or
> corrupted.
>
>
>> 2019-01-31 13:33:10 27551 [17279]: leader2 path
>> /var/run/vdsm/storage/808423f9-8a5c-40cd-bc9f-2568c85b8c74/2c74697a-8bd9-4472-8a98-bf624f3462d5/411b6cee-5b01-47ca-8c28-bb1fed8ac83b
>> offset 0
>> 2019-01-31 13:33:10 27551 [17279]: leader3 m 0 v 30003 ss 512 nh 0 mh 1
>> oi 0 og 0 lv 0
>> 2019-01-31 13:33:10 27551 [17279]: leader4 sn hosted-engine rn  ts 0 cs
>> 60346c59
>> 2019-01-31 13:33:11 27551 [21482]: s6 add_lockspace fail result -223
>> 2019-01-31 13:33:16 27556 [21482]: s7 lockspace
>> hosted-engine:1:/var/run/vdsm/storage/808423f9-8a5c-40cd-bc9f-2568c85b8c74/2c74697a-8bd9-4472-8a98-bf624f3462d5/411b6cee-5b01-47ca-8c28-bb1fe
>> d8ac83b:0
>>
>>
>> I have managed to fix it by running the following immediately after the
>> ha services were started by ansible:
>>
>> cd
>> /rhev/data-center/mnt/glusterSD/ovirt1.localdomain\:_engine/808423f9-8a5c-40cd-bc9f-2568c85b8c74/ha_agent/
>>
>
> This is not a path managed by vdsm, so I guess the issue is with hosted
> enigne
> specific lockspace that is managed by hosted engine, not by vdsm.
>
>
>> sanlock direct init -s hosted-engine:0:hosted-engine.lockspace:0
>>
>
> This formats the lockspace, and is expected to fix this issue.
>
>
>
>> systemctl stop ovirt-ha-agent ovirt-ha-broker
>> systemctl status vdsmd
>> systemctl start ovirt-ha-broker ovirt-ha-agent
>>
>> Once the VM started - ansible managed to finish the deployment without
>> any issues.
